Ravhan Hawkins' Rushing Yards a New Career-High
Starting off the list is Alliance's Ravhan Hawkins, who we judged to be the best player in the league this week. On Friday Hawkins rushed for 165 yards and four touchdowns while picking up 8.7 yards per carry, good enough to set a new career-high in rushing yards in the process.
This year, Hawkins has run in 11 touchdowns while averaging 75.9 rushing yards per game.

JR Jackson Makes It Two for Alliance
Keeping Hawkins company is JR Jackson, a fellow Alliance player. He rushed for 118 yards and a touchdown on only 11 carries, and also threw for 111 yards on only eight passes.
On the season, Jackson has averaged 127.3 passing yards per game. It gets even more impressive: after ten games last season, he was only averaging 0.4 rushing yards per game. This year he is averaging 46.6 rushing yards.

Thomas Posts Huge Game in 26-7 Victory
West Branch picked up their tenth consecutive win on Friday thanks in part to Jeremiah Thomas. Salem had no answer to Thomas as he rushed for 94 yards and two touchdowns on only 13 carries, and also threw for 121 yards and a touchdown.
West Branch's victory was their 12th stra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 10-0. Thomas and West Branch will host Hubbard at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.

West Branch Wins Tenth-Straight Thanks to Boston Mulinix
Boston Mulinix was instrumental in extending West Branch's winning streak to ten on Friday. Mulinix was unstoppable, rushing for 167 yards and a touchdown. That's the most rushing yards he has posted since back in September of 2023.
Mulinix must have Salem's number; he was a force to be reckoned with the last time he faced them too. When Mulinix last faced the Quakers back in October of 2023, he rushed for 112 yards and three touchdowns on only eight carries.

Malachi Thomas-Allen Makes It Three for Alliance
Another Alliance player making an appearance on this list is Malachi Thomas-Allen. He wasn't messing around on Friday, picking up a sack, forcing a fumble, and making seven total tackles (4.0 for loss). The game was his fifth straight with five or more total tackles.
For the year, Thomas-Allen has averaged 7.6 total tackles per game and for the season has 3 sacks.
